List by list
England and Wales · Girls18 shared years, 1997–2021
Carol held the stronger position in 10 of those years, Viviana in 7.
Highest recorded here: Carol #897 in 1997, Viviana #1586 in 2018.
The order changed in 2015: Viviana moved ahead. In 2014 they stood at #3160 and #4050; by 2015 that had become #4103 and #2496.
Most recent shared year, 2021: Carol #3519, Viviana #1962.

How each name got here
Carol
Popularity journey
First recorded1952
First recorded at #26 among girls in New South Wales, Australia in 1952 — the earliest year that source publishes this name, not necessarily the earliest it was used.
New South Wales, Australia · Girls
Highest recorded1954–1971
Highest recorded position: #19 among girls in New Zealand, in 1957 (recorded 1954–1971).
New Zealand · Girls
Most recent2023
Most recently recorded at #3523 among boys in England and Wales, in 2023.
